Output 793037379150dcdfa24108a62a0018aa316f4dbfb0219d6294bb70f4eae6fc43:15
- value
- 384477
- script pubkey
- OP_0 OP_PUSHBYTES_20 e21589b36d905547527a0d418a7e25742adedab4
- address
- bc1qug2cnvmdjp25w5n6p4qc5l39ws4dak458l8tyg
- transaction
- 793037379150dcdfa24108a62a0018aa316f4dbfb0219d6294bb70f4eae6fc43